Background technique
JB/T 7664-2005 compressed air purifying term has made as given a definition oil: oil is by six or six or more carbon Former molecular hydrocarbon.Oil in compressed air mostlys come from compressor, there is the lubricating oil of oil lubricating compressor Always it is into compressed air.Traditional oilless (oil free) compressor is also difficult to ensure generation oil-free compressed air, because of this in air Body contains oil contaminants.Even if hydrocarbon in air contains in the grass roots that motor vehicles are rare, industrialization degree is low Amount is still more than the 1 grade standard (oil content≤0.01mg/m of ISO8571-1 defined3).
ISO 8573-1 international standard and GBT 13277.1-2008 national standard all define compressed air pollutant Clean level.Oil can be deposited in compressed air with one of three kinds of states (liquid, suspended state and oil vapour) or diversified forms ?.
In the application field more demanding to compressed air quality, such as food and drink, medicine, electronics industry, no oil pressure The determination of contracting air can produce extremely important.There are many traditional air compressors, its inner utilization high-precision currently on the market Piston and piston cylinder the cooperation compressed air that ensures to generate without sprinkling lubricating oil it is oil-free, but have one here Problem is exactly that these air compressor machines generally work in factory area, and the air of factory itself is because be also all largely oil content in fact Relatively high, many plant sites through measuring, oil content has been over 5mg/m3 to their ontology air in fact.So this The so-called traditional oilless (oil free) compressor of kind can not be accomplished oil-free in fact.

Referring to Fig. 1-2, a kind of device can produce oil-free compressed air, including air compressor 1, dried-air drier 2 It further include compressed air degreasing unit 4 with air accumulator 3, one end of compressed air degreasing unit 4 is fixedly connected with air compressor 1, Its other end is sequentially connected dried-air drier 2 and air accumulator 3, and compressed air degreasing unit 4 includes pedestal 41, fixes on pedestal 41 Catalytic reactor 42, heat exchanger 43 and electronic control unit 44 are set, and heater 45 is arranged in the external of catalytic reactor 42, and catalysis is anti- It answers the top and bottom of tank 42 to pass through setting pipeline 46 to be fixedly connected with heat exchanger 43, be respectively set out on heat exchanger 43 Tracheae 47 and air inlet pipe 48, electronic control unit 44 are electrically connected with catalytic reactor 42, heat exchanger 43 and heater 45 respectively.
In the present embodiment, temperature sensor 49, and each temperature are fixedly installed at the upper, middle and lower three of catalytic reactor 42 Sensor 49 is spent to be electrically connected with electronic control unit 44.Temperature sensor 49 can be to 42 upper, middle and lower three of catalytic reactor at Temperature carries out real-time monitoring, as long as detection exceeds the temperature of setting range, transmits signals to electronic control unit 44, automatically controlled list at once Member 44 can control corresponding component closing.
In the present embodiment, solenoid valve 410 is respectively provided on escape pipe 47 and air inlet pipe 48, also fixed setting is pacified on escape pipe 47 Pressure gauge 412 is also fixedly installed in air inlet pipe 47 in full valve 411.Solenoid valve 410 both can protect present apparatus stable operation, can also Guarantee that the gas spilt out is all clean oil-free compressed air, downstream will not be polluted with gas end.
